Family and friends of Heidi Scheepers (35) came together during a touching memorial service at Eden Place Church on Saturday to pay their last respects and say farewell to her and her two children, Cozette (6) and Hugo (2), George Herald reports.

Beautiful tributes were paid to the young mother and her children who went missing on Tuesday 22 October after what was meant to be a quick visit to Herold’s Bay beach, a popular beach not far from their home in Oubaai.

The vehicle they were travelling in at the time of their disappearance was found at the bottom of a cliff in the Voëlklip area near Herold’s Bay the next day.

Hugo and Heidi’s bodies have since been recovered from the water. Until today there has been no trace of Cozette.
